as for the avensis=venza, that is wrong. they share nothing aside from shape, and are two completely different derivatives of their original platform. the avensis is a much lower vehicle (even in estate configuration as posted), and is a derivative of the caldina platform, not the camry platform that the venza is derived from. in fact, to get a general idea of the shape, think of a stretched scion tC (hence the tC's chopped rear end). the tC and avensis share chassis. it's like how some people say that the hilux and taco are relatives, when in reality, they only share engines. two unrelated truck platforms that split up in the late 80's.
